Door frame beveling device
Technical Field
The utility model relates to the field of anti-theft door production, in particular to a door frame beveling device.
Background
With the increasing income and living standard of residents, people continuously pursue better decorative effect while improving the household anti-theft performance. The anti-theft door frame integrates an anti-theft structure and decoration, and not only has an anti-theft notch matched with an anti-theft door leaf and a bent hook edge matched with a wall, but also has different folding shapes on the outer surface. Due to the particularity of the shape and the structure, the door frame workpiece needs to be obliquely cut by 45 degrees to the left door stop, the right door stop and the upper door stop after being folded and formed, and the following problems exist in the oblique cutting process: firstly because the particularity of door frame shape structure can not both ends fixed when miscut, can only single-end fixed, and door frame work piece produces to beat and warp among the cutting process, leads to corner cut yielding and unevenness, not only influences the decorative effect of product, but also influences the speed and the quality of installation. Secondly, the cutting precision is low, the miter saw is generally used for manual operation during blanking, the problems of high processing and positioning difficulty and low processing speed exist, and the problems of cut burrs, deviation, poor flatness and inaccurate angle cutting exist during processing, and further improvement is needed.

The working principle of the utility model is as follows:
when the device is used, the position of the stop block 24 is adjusted according to the length of the cut angle, the door frame single side 45 is placed, the upper fastening bolt 42, the next fastening bolt 43 and the second fastening bolt 44 are screwed, the rotary disc 21 is rotated anticlockwise until the convex rod 22 is contacted with the limiting screw rod 16, the handle 33 is held by a hand, and the motor 34 is started to cut. After the completion, the lifting posture can be maintained by lifting the tray 31 and straddling the fixed bracket 12 and the hanging plate 37 with the gate-shaped clamp 13.
